This typeface is a compact, heavy sans with rounded terminals and broadly uniform stroke thickness. Curves are full and smooth, giving counters a circular/oval feel, while joins and corners are slightly softened rather than sharply cut. Proportions are tight and sturdy, with wide stems and relatively small internal counters that maintain clarity at display sizes. The overall rhythm is dense and confident, with a consistent, utilitarian geometry across letters and numerals.

Best suited to headlines and short statements where strong typographic color is an advantage, such as posters, packaging, signage, and brand marks. It also works well for punchy UI labels or promotional graphics where a friendly, high-impact sans is needed and the text is not overly long.

The overall tone is warm and upbeat, balancing a solid, dependable presence with a distinctly casual, slightly retro charm. Its rounded shapes and chunky weight read as friendly and accessible rather than technical or severe, making it feel inviting and informal while still assertive.

The design appears intended to provide an energetic, approachable display sans that delivers strong emphasis without feeling harsh. By combining dense weight with rounded finishing and simple, consistent construction, it aims for immediate readability and a personable voice in attention-grabbing contexts.

The lowercase shows a straightforward, workmanlike construction with simple bowls and minimal modulation, helping text remain clear despite the heavy color. Numerals follow the same rounded, compact logic and appear designed to stand out strongly in headings and UI-style callouts.
